Overview: The Boynton Beach City Commission meeting on March 26 primarily focused on updating the city’s comprehensive plan, a long-range blueprint crucial for guiding the city’s land use, transportation, and conservation strategies. Discussions were colored by the implications of Senate Bill 180, which limits local government policies in disaster-declared counties, raising concerns about potential legal challenges and compliance complexities. The meeting also touched upon the need for public feedback, transportation infrastructure, and economic development, while public comments highlighted issues like noise pollution and the role of art in city planning.

Overview: The Indian River County Planning and Zoning Commission convened to discuss the proposed development of Vero Classical School, a private K-12 educational facility seeking special exemption use and site plan approval. The project, located in an A1 agricultural district, stirred debate, particularly around traffic management, infrastructure, and community impact. The Commission recommended the approval of the special exemption use and phase one site plan, pending further approval from the Board of County Commissioners, with stipulations addressing road construction, landscaping, and student enrollment limits.

Overview: The Escambia County Council meeting was marked by a divisive debate over the customary use of privately owned beach property, particularly in Puro Key. The meeting saw discussions as community stakeholders, property owners, and council members grappled with the implications of beach access and property rights. Key issues included the legal and financial ramifications of enforcing customary use, the balance between public access and private property rights, and the potential economic impact on the community. The meeting also touched on development projects, property acquisitions, and funding challenges related to the Outlying Fields initiative.
